如何使用SNMP监视Java进程



我需要使用SNMP监视Java进程。需要帮助如何使用Net-SNMP监视Java流程

我的查询是用于net-snmp:

我必须为我的Java过程创建MIB吗?SNMP代理如何获得状态?它是否运行一些脚本来收集状态报告?脚本应该在哪里配置?如果我有MIB文件,将足以与SNMP代理使用,或者我还必须编写一些脚本?

java可以自己为您提供SNMP信息。请参阅SNMP监视和管理。

您需要使用" com.sun.management.snmp.port " System Propertie和 acl文件。。。

问题在于,如果它崩溃,它将不会发送陷阱,您可以获取" live/running"信息。

要监视Java过程本身(它是活的还是死亡,在崩溃时发送陷阱)必须使用外部工具,例如使用proc指令配置的Net-SNMP和" disman event mib 。有关更多信息,请参见Man页面。

最新更新